## Connection Pooling — Limits and Quotas

All services at Norbeck talking to the Casswell cluster go through the shared `poolkit` library. Each service gets its own pool; pools are capped so that the sum across services stays under the database's global connection limit. Exceeding your cap queues the request rather than opening a new connection, and long queue waits page the owning team. If you need a bigger cap, file a quota request first. The default pool constants are listed below.

constants for tageg-kagag:
QUOTAS = {
    "kelax": 495,
    "istath": 366,
    "tammir": 108,
    "novdor": 730,
    "casax": 816,
    "quenael": 874,
    "pelius": 403,
}

**Vendor note: Inkmill markdown pipeline**

Rendering for Parchway docs is outsourced to Inkmill under an annual contract, renewing each March. They handle sanitization and PDF export; we own the upload queue. SLA: 4-hour response on rendering failures. Escalate only after two failed retries. Their support desk is reachable at the address below.

billing contact of hahaf-baguf = zorael.tammir.jorius@sivrelhq.internal

### Step 4: Push the build

Almost there. Once Diffalo's chunked renderer passes the large-file smoke test (try it on anything over 500 MB), package the build and push it to the staging bucket. Don't hand-edit the manifest — the deploy script regenerates it anyway. Future maintainers: yes, the pipeline is picky about signatures on purpose. Sign the bundle with the deploy key shown below.

rollout seal: bky9_PeXH1fTLY

Subject: Release handover — InvoicePress renderer

Hi team,

Handing over InvoicePress 4.2 release duties for the week. The PDF renderer build is staged and verified; the Fernbeck pipeline signed it last night without warnings. Please do not re-trigger the signing stage — it invalidates the staged artifact. If you must verify the bundle manually during an incident, use the active release signing key below.

deploy key for kajof-yawif: bky9_fvxrpdHPq